What companies run services between Coventry, England and Billund, Denmark?

KLM, Scandinavian Airlines, and two other airlines fly from Birmingham Airport (BHX) to Billund Airport (BLL) 5 times a day.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Belgrade Theatre to Billund Centret via Bullring, Birmingham, Gent-Dampoort, Ghent Dampoort, Kolding bus station, and Kolding Busterminal in around 26h 31m.
